Now that I've had time to fully digest this album, I can honestly say that it's really really good. To me, the production on this is probably the best I've heard on a TDE album since Section.80 and Isaiah Rashad is a more than capable rapper. I won't lie, at points on the album he does eerily sound like Kendrick though. Initially, I thought Kendrick was doing BVs on one of the songs, that's how similar they sound. There's only 2 songs on here that didn't move so that's a high success rate.
